GDS Holdings Ltd. Seeks Unprecedented $3.4 Billion Loan to Fuel Expansion

In a significant development highlighting the surging need for digital infrastructure, GDS Holdings Ltd., a prominent Chinese data center operator, is in the spotlight as it seeks an extraordinary $3.4 billion loan. With businesses globally increasingly dependent on cloud solutions and data management services, GDS aims to harness this growing market by enhancing its operational capabilities. The company operates a sophisticated network of data centers throughout China and intends to utilize this substantial financing to bolster its growth strategy in an ever-changing technological environment. This ambitious loan request not only reflects GDS’s aggressive expansion ambitions but also mirrors broader trends impacting the data center sector amid escalating global data usage and technological progress.

GDS Holdings’ Ambitious Loan Initiative

As one of the leading entities in China’s data center industry,GDS is making waves with its pursuit of a remarkable $3.4 billion loan aimed at accelerating its growth trajectory. This funding initiative is primarily designed to meet the skyrocketing demand for cloud services and robust data storage solutions driven by ongoing digital transformation across various sectors.

The firm’s strategic focus includes:

  • Infrastructure Development: Allocating resources towards constructing new state-of-the-art data centers.
  • Technological Upgrades: Enhancing existing facilities with cutting-edge technology.
  • Diversification Beyond Borders: Investigating opportunities outside of China’s market.

This approach is crucial for GDS as it strives to strengthen its competitive position while addressing the increasing demand for dependable data center services.The proposed loan may also signify investor confidence in GDS’s operational efficiency and long-term growth potential, showcasing how financial strategies intertwine with technology advancements within a rapidly evolving marketplace.

Driving Forces Behind GDS’s Loan Request

The substantial $3.4 billion loan sought by GDS stems from several pivotal factors that are propelling its expansion efforts and operational improvements. Primarily, there has been an explosive rise in cloud computing alongside digital transformation across multiple industries, significantly increasing demand for high-quality data center services.

The company aims to leverage this trend by deploying next-generation infrastructure capable of handling extensive workloads and advanced applications while solidifying its presence in major urban areas where competition intensifies necessitating considerable investments into modern facilities.

Additonally, advancements in artificial intelligence (AI) and big-data analytics require enhanced computing power and storage solutions; thus, optimizing their offerings will allow them to lead within the industry effectively.The requested funds will also enable strategic acquisitions or partnerships that can further enhance their operational capabilities—making this funding request not just about capital but rather a calculated move toward lasting growth amidst fierce competition driven by technological innovation.
